I ran a server for a ISP for nearly 2 years on a aging server box - win 2000 Server(<i>which does support dual CPU´s if the software does </i> note FL doesn´t) / Dual p3 1gig´s / Gig of ram, using FLadmin / IFSO and lastly FLAC Now origionally it was a standard FL with No mods and fine for about 24 players with no lag but more and then the hardware load would increase. 1. flserver.exe /p port number eg flserver.exe /p 2302 That forces it to use 2302 helpful if it you have players that direct link to it which require a set port
Just get <A href=´http://www.lancersreactor.org/t/Download/Download.asp?ID=1273´ Target=_Blank>IFSO</a> and edit the loadout´s but: 1. make a character and kick move it to a base with the ship and buy it, plus fill the weapon/equipment slots with low grade items. 2. leave the server in that character and then edit it via IFSO upgrading the weapons etc. This way because building a ship from scratch from a flyer as the base can induce visual annomilies and problems later.

<b>You </b> join from lan not the public listing unless you are trying to play from work/school etc. If not on the lan that is hosting the pc then you will have to open further ports 2300 - 2305 should be enough.
